Essential Functions

  • Provide technical support for SMT manufacturing operations

  • Determine line configurations for new products

  • Establish effective and efficient manufacturing processes

  • Review products and recommend design/process enhancements

  • Monitor and improve screen print, reflow, water wash, and flow solder processes

  • Develop and update work instructions and manufacturing methods

  • Work with vendors on product specifications, equipment/material purchases, and quality standards

  • Determine workforce utilization and space requirements

  • Design equipment and workspace layouts for safety, efficiency, and ergonomics

  • Analyze and resolve work problems; assist workers in problem-solving

  • Install, layout, and adjust special production equipment and tooling

  • Provide technical leadership as needed
